Useful:
  • Canonical SMILES:C(=O)(C(F)(F)S(=O)(=O)F)O
  • Uses An important reagent in the synthesis of difluorocarbenes and difluorocyclopropanes. Difluorocarbene source for the difluoromethylation of alcohols. 2,2-Difluoro-2-(fluorosulfonyl)acetic acid, is used as an important raw material and intermediate used in organic Synthesis, pharmaceuticals, agrochemicals and dyestuff. It is also used as an important reagent in the synthesis of difluorocarbenes and difluorocyclopropanes.
